/** Shopify CDN: Minification failed

Line 137:108 Expected "}" to go with "{"

**/
.web-text .rich-text {
  margin-left: auto;
  margin-right: auto;
  text-align: center;
  z-index: 1;
}

.web-text .rich-text.rich-text--full-width {
  max-width: initial;
  width: 100%;
}

.web-text .rich-text__blocks {
  margin: auto;
  /* 2.5rem margin on left & right */
  /* width: calc(100% - 5rem / var(--font-body-scale)); */
}

.web-text .rich-text__blocks * {
  overflow-wrap: break-word;
}

.web-text .rich-text--full-width .rich-text__blocks {
  /* 4rem (1.5rem + 2.5rem) margin on left & right */
  /* width: calc(100% - 8rem / var(--font-body-scale)); */
}

@media screen and (min-width: 750px) {
/*   .rich-text__blocks {
    max-width: 50rem;
  } */

 .web-text  .rich-text--full-width .rich-text__blocks {
    /* 7.5rem (5rem + 2.5rem) margin on left & right */
    /* width: calc(100% - 15rem); */
  }
}

@media screen and (min-width: 990px) {
  .web-text .rich-text__blocks {
    /* max-width: 78rem; */
  }
}

/* Blocks */

.web-text .rich-text__blocks > * {
  margin-top: 0;
  margin-bottom: 0;
}

.web-text .rich-text__blocks > * + * {
  margin-top: 2rem;
}

.web-text .rich-text__blocks > * + a {
  margin-top: 5rem;
}

/* custom css */
.web-text .rich-text-1:after{background-color:rgba(var(--color-base-accent-1),0.5);}
.web-text .rich-text-1 .rich-text__blocks h2{ line-height: 60px;
    text-transform: inherit;
    font-size: var(--font-h3-size);
    font-family: var(--font-heading-family);
    /* letter-spacing: .02em; */
    font-weight: 400;
    color: var(--gradient-background);}
.web-text .rich-text-1 .rich-text__blocks .rich-text__text p{ color: var(--gradient-background);
    font-size: var(--font-h4-size);
    font-weight: 400;
    /* letter-spacing: 7px; */
    font-family: var(--font-body-family);
    line-height: 30px;
max-width: 57%;
 margin-bottom: 5px;}
.web-text .rich-text-1.color-background-2 .button--secondary {  --color-button: var(--color-foreground);   --color-button-text: var(--color-background);  min-width: calc(18rem + var(--buttons-border-width) * 2);  min-height: calc(4.7rem + var(--buttons-border-width) * 2);}
.web-text .rich-text-1.color-background-2 .button--secondary:after{--border-opacity:0;}
.web-text .rich-text-1.color-background-2 .button--secondary:after{display:none;}
@media screen and (max-width: 425px) {
/* .web-text .rich-text-1 .rich-text__blocks .rich-text__text p {font-size:5.0rem;} */
}
@media screen and (max-width: 767px) {
  /* .web-text .rich-text-1 .rich-text__blocks .rich-text__text p{line-height:normal}
.web-text .rich-text-1 .rich-text__blocks .rich-text__text p{ font-size:3.5rem;} */
  .web-text .rich-text-1 .rich-text__blocks .rich-text__text p{max-width:100%;}
}
.web-text .web-readmore{
  text-decoration: underline;
    color: var(--gradient-background);
}
.web-text .web-readmore:hover{
  color: rgba(var(--color-foreground), 1);
}

.web-text .web-readmore:hover svg{transform: scale(-1,1 );}
    .web-text .rich-text--full-width .rich-text__blocks{
      width:100%; padding: 2rem;
    }
.web-text .rich-text__text{
  text-align: center;
    display: flex;
    align-items: center;
    justify-content: center;
}
.web-text-button-parent{
  display: flex;
    justify-content: center;
}
.web-text .rich-text{
  display: flex;
  
}
.web-text-button-parent svg{
  width:16px;
  height:16px; margin-left:10px;
}
.rtl-mode .web-text-button-parent svg{
  width:16px;
  height:16px; margin-right:10px;margin-left:0;
}
.web-text-button-parent span{
  /* margin-bottom: -3px; */
}
.web-text .Yellow{
  font-weight: 800;
}
.web-text-button{display: flex;
    justify-content: center;
    align-items: end;}
@media(max-width:576px) {
  .web-text .rich-text-1 .rich-text__blocks .rich-text__text p {font-size: calc(.65 * var(--font-h4-size));}